5 Easy Ways to Relieve Neck and Shoulder Pain

on

Do you suffer from neck pain? Neck Pain affects 45% of today’s workers and 12% of adult females and 9% of adult males. It’s also a common cause of worker disability. The good news is that you can often relieve neck pain by following some simple steps. Here are 5 easy ways to relieve neck & shoulder pain.

Practice Good Posture

Not surprisingly, neck pain & shoulder often occurs as a result of poor posture. Pay attention to your neck position when you’re on the computer or phone. Also, when standing and sitting pay attention to your neck and shoulder position. Following this tip will go a long ways in protecting your neck from injury and associated pain.

Take Frequent Breaks

When you travel long distances, if work long hours at your computer, or if you just stay in a particular position for an extended time, get up, move around and stretch your neck and shoulders.

Exercise

I know this is easier said than done when you suffer from chronic neck & shoulder pain, but staying active can actually help to reduce pain and discomfort. This doesn’t necessarily mean that you have to hit the gym every other day lifting weights. Rather, try going jogging — or even walking — for 30 minutes in the evening. Light cardiovascular activity encourages blood flow while also protecting against common forms of injury. Also, check out the exercise link below.

Yoga

Yoga is an excellent activity that offers a wide range of health benefits, including a positive impact on neck & shoulder pain. It involves flexing and stretching, which in turn promotes a wider range of motion. Many people who struggle with chronic neck and shoulder pain rely on yoga to lessen their pain.

Acupuncture

Acupuncture also can offer relief of neck and shoulder pain. While it depends on the root cause of your neck and shoulder pain, many people have reported great success using acupuncture and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) for the treatment of neck and shoulder injuries and pain.
